Key Differences
Pros of Qualcomm Snapdragon 680
- Snapdragon 680 has 65.04% higher GPU clock speed than Snapdragon 860 (1114 vs 675 MHz).
- Snapdragon 680 has 14.29% smaller sized transistor than Snapdragon 860 (6 vs 7 nm).
Pros of Qualcomm Snapdragon 860
- Snapdragon 860 has 23.33% higher CPU clock speed than Snapdragon 680 (2960 vs 2400 MHz).
- Snapdragon 860 has 84.43% better AnTuTu 9 score than Snapdragon 680 (464 K vs 252 K ).
- Snapdragon 860 has latest instruction set, hence better than Snapdragon 680.
- Snapdragon 860 Support 100.76% higher memory bandwidth then Snapdragon 680 (34.13 vs 17 GB/s).
